What flower is on the Hong Kong flag and what does it symbolize?

1. What flower is the Hong Kong flag?

The flower on the Hong Kong flag is the Bauhinia. Bauhinia is a tree or shrub of the genus Cercis in the Fabaceae family. Its flowers usually bloom in clusters of 4-10 before the leaves appear. It has many varieties, most of which have purple or rose-red flowers, and a few are white. It is the district flower of Hong Kong and also the school flower of Tsinghua University.

2. Symbolic Meaning

1. Family affection: Bauhinia can represent family affection and has the symbolic meaning of family reunion. This flower is painted on the flag of Hong Kong, symbolizing the strong kinship between Hong Kong and the mainland.

2. One Country, Two Systems: The background colour of the Hong Kong flag is red with a white bauhinia flower painted on it. Red is the color of the Chinese national flag and can represent the motherland, while Bauhinia is the regional flag of the Hong Kong Special Administrative Region and can represent Hong Kong. So it can also represent that Hong Kong belongs to China. The difference in color between the two can also represent "one country, two systems".

3. Related legends

According to legend, more than a hundred years ago, in order to resist the invasion of British invaders, countless ancestors took up arms and fought bravely one after another. After the war, people built a large tomb on Guijiao Mountain to bury the martyrs who had died. After several years, a beautiful flower grew on the mountain that had never appeared before. This flower soon bloomed all over Hong Kong. In order to commemorate the martyrs who had sacrificed their lives, people named this flower Bauhinia.
